Output 1ffc31d46dd2335a5d74a88f2aca27833363f3bcb58c3595c4fe73460f03d497:2

value
26292394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9e97e67c9f3c35ce2d3f7de008ccf018bf4586f OP_EQUAL
address
3L6dTXtJ9iDorjzaoQ46cGGhyCtw6DYoqC
transaction
1ffc31d46dd2335a5d74a88f2aca27833363f3bcb58c3595c4fe73460f03d497
confirmations
517289
spent
true